Caput XIV Chapter 14
Term | Definition |
---|---|
agō, agere | to do, drive |
ars, artis | f. skill |
celerrimē | very fast |
cessō, cessāre | to be idle, do nothing |
commotus | moved |
concidō, concidere | to fall down |
culpa, -ae | f. fault, blame |
tuā culpā | because of your fault, it’s your fault that |
cunctī | all |
devertēbat | he began to turn aside |
extrahō, extrahere | to drag out |
frustrā | in vain |
gaudeō, gaudere | to be glad |
haereō, haerēre | to stick |
incolumis | unhurt, safe and sound |
interpellō, interpellāre | to interrupt |
moveō, movēre | to move |
noster | our |
periculum | danger |
placidē | gently, peacefully |
fulmen, fulminis | n. lightning |
navis, navis | f. ship, boat |
raeda, -ae | f. carriage |
raedarius, -i | m. coachman |
omnia | everything |
omnes | everyone |
